Imaging technique can differentiate Alzheimer's disease from dementia with Lewy bodies

Scientists in Portugal and the United Kingdom were able to confirm that an imaging technique that traces neuronal dopaminergic deficiency in the brain is able to differentiate, in vivo, Alzheimer's disease from lesser-known dementia with Lewy bodies.

COVID-19 lockdown affecting UK adult mental health

As the sever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2 (SARS-CoV-2) took a firmer hold on the UK, the government introduced a lockdown on March 24, 2020, in an all-out attempt to ‘flatten the curve' of infections. While the number of deaths has fallen in response, a new study published in the journal medRxiv in April 2020 reports that the pandemic is also associated with increased anxiety and depression in UK adults experiencing isolation.

Roundup: Calif. employer health premiums soar 170% over decade; Minn. hospitals allege blues cut hospital payments; Mass. AG warns on hospital sale market impact

Premiums for employer health insurance in California jumped 170 percent over the last decade, more than five times the 32 percent increase in the state's inflation rate. That escalation in premiums has taken a toll on employers' willingness to offer health benefits, according to an annual survey by the California HealthCare Foundation (Terhune, 4/24).

Primary Care Clinics: Primary care clinics provide day-to-day healthcare services to patients. Primary care acts as the principal point of continuous healthcare for patients and also coordinates specialist care as may be required by the patient. Primary care is usually provided by general practitioners, family medicine doctors.
